#001c58 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#001c58 is composed of 0% red, 11% green and 34.5%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 100% cyan, 68.2% magenta, 0% yellow and 65.5% black. It has a hue angle of 220.9 degrees, a saturation of 100% and a lightness of 17.3%. #001c58 color hex could be obtained by blending #0038b0 with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#003366.

● #001c58 color description : Very dark blue.
#001c58 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#001c58 has RGB values of R:0, G:28, B:88 and CMYK values of C:1, M:0.68, Y:0, K:0.65. Its decimal value is 7256.
